Interface ID3D10EffectType (d3d10effect.h)
A interface ID3D10EffectType acessa variáveis de efeito por tipo.
O tempo de vida de um objeto ID3D10EffectType é igual ao tempo de vida de seu objeto ID3D10Effect pai.
Método | Descrição |
---|---|
GetDesc | Obtenha uma descrição de tipo de efeito. |
GetMemberName | Obtenha o nome de um membro. |
GetMemberSemantic | Obter a semântica anexada a um membro. |
GetMemberTypeByIndex | Obter um tipo de membro por índice. |
GetMemberTypeByName | Obtenha um tipo de membro por nome. |
GetMemberTypeBySemantic | Obter um tipo de membro por semântica. |
Isvalid | Testa se o tipo de efeito é válido. |
Métodos
A interface ID3D10EffectType tem esses métodos.
ID3D10EffectType::GetDesc Obtenha uma descrição de tipo de efeito. |
ID3D10EffectType::GetMemberName Obtenha o nome de um membro. |
ID3D10EffectType::GetMemberSemantic Obter a semântica anexada a um membro. |
ID3D10EffectType::GetMemberTypeByIndex Obter um tipo de membro por índice. |
ID3D10EffectType::GetMemberTypeByName Obtenha um tipo de membro por nome. |
ID3D10EffectType::GetMemberTypeBySemantic Obter um tipo de membro por semântica. |
ID3D10EffectType::IsValid Testa se o tipo de efeito é válido. |
Comentários
Para obter informações sobre um tipo de efeito de uma variável de efeito, chame ID3D10EffectVariable::GetType.
Requisitos
Requisito | Valor |
---|---|
Plataforma de Destino | Windows |
Cabeçalho | d3d10effect.h |